The Glimmerboard admin dashboard uses a dedicated service account to fetch theme preferences, including the dark-mode toggle state, from the Prefstore service. Dark-mode rendering is resolved server-side so the first paint matches the user's saved theme; do not move this logic client-side without updating the cache headers. The service account has read-only scope on the theming namespace and nothing else. If the account is rotated, update the deploy secrets the same day. The current key for the Prefstore service account is below.

gateway credential: kto23_LX9A4ys6i4nzHtpOLNLodKK

## Authentication

So you want your plugin to talk to the Lanewise address autocomplete widget? Easy. Every request from your plugin goes through the Lanewise suggestion gateway, which checks a key before returning any candidate addresses. Don't try to scrape the widget's DOM instead — rate limiting will bite you, and the results aren't stable anyway. Grab a plugin key from your Lanewise dashboard, drop it into your plugin config, and you're done. For local testing against the sandbox gateway, use the key below.

API key for yahig-tadup: kto7_ubizbYm

Handover Note — From Director H. Calloway to Director P. Ysmer

On the large-deal discount policy: deals above the enterprise threshold require dual sign-off, and discounts beyond 20% need a finance exception memo. Recent deals in the Norvane region stretched these limits; please review the exception log carefully. Sales leads should continue quoting standard bands until the revised framework is ratified. The forward intentions are recorded below.

confidential, yagep-kagef: Rusvanox Holdings is in early talks to buy Julwynix Systems for about $454.5 million. The Fenael launch date is April 23, and nothing goes to the press before then. Legal wants the Druwynix Works term sheet redrafted before January 8.